From af3dc599c16e5d590d24de96e597ae3aaa3a91b6 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E8=B5=B5=E5=BF=A0=E6=9E=97?= <170083662@qq.com> Date: Fri, 3 Jan 2025 17:15:44 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=EF=BC=9A=E8=B0=83=E6=95=B4?= =?UTF-8?q?=E8=8E=B7=E5=8F=96TenantId=E9=A1=BA=E5=BA=8F?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../gxwebsoft/common/core/web/BaseController.java |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) diff --git a/src/main/java/com/gxwebsoft/common/core/web/BaseController.java b/src/main/java/com/gxwebsoft/common/core/web/BaseController.java index 9edba14..8c5f48d 100644 --- a/src/main/java/com/gxwebsoft/common/core/web/BaseController.java +++ b/src/main/java/com/gxwebsoft/common/core/web/BaseController.java @@ -78,21 +78,21 @@ public class BaseController { if (loginUser != null) { return loginUser.getTenantId(); } - // 2 从域名拿ID + // 2 从请求头拿ID + String tenantId = request.getHeader("tenantId"); + if(StrUtil.isNotBlank(tenantId)){ + return Integer.valueOf(tenantId); + } + // 3 从域名拿ID String Domain = request.getHeader("Domain"); if (StrUtil.isNotBlank(Domain)) { String key = "Domain:" + Domain; - String tenantId = redisUtil.get(key); + tenantId = redisUtil.get(key); if(tenantId != null){ System.out.println("从域名拿ID = " + tenantId); return Integer.valueOf(tenantId); } } - // 3 从请求头拿ID - String tenantId = request.getHeader("tenantId"); - if(StrUtil.isNotBlank(tenantId)){ - return Integer.valueOf(tenantId); - } return null; }